Emily Osment is coming to Elitch Gardens for a free concert tomorrow night and my two kids, ages nine and seven, couldn’t be more excited. Why? Well, because I apparently have let them listen to Radio Disney a lot and watch the Disney Channel.
Oh, and if you don’t know who Emily Osment is, then you don’t deserve to be a Hannah Montana fan, anyway. (Osment plays Lilly Truscott, Montana’s best friend on the show.)
But Osment kind of rocks. In fact — and don’t tell anyone — I have been known to keep Radio Disney on in the car even after I drop off the kids at camp or school. Osment, Jordan Sparks, Miley Cyrus, Selena Gomez.

Check out Osment and Allstar Weekend on Saturday, July 31, at 7 p.m. The concert is free with park admission, but there is limited seating, so get a wristband (they’re available first-come, first-serve) at the tent near the Elitch Arena before 6:30 pm.
